Mumbai-Ahmedabad Bullet Train Corridor Route

High-Speed Rail Corridor – This is a significant section of India's first high-speed rail corridor, famously known as the Bullet Train project. This route, passing through areas like Nandesari – Dodka Road in Rayaka, Gujarat, is part of the ambitious infrastructure connecting two major economic hubs.

What is this place?

Future Rail Link – This specific location refers to a segment of the under-construction Mumbai-Ahmedabad Bullet Train Corridor. It represents a vital part of the future high-speed rail network designed to revolutionize inter-city travel between Mumbai and Ahmedabad .

Purpose of the Corridor

Faster Connectivity – People will utilize this corridor primarily for rapid and efficient travel between the financial capital of India, Mumbai, and the industrial hub of Ahmedabad. It aims to significantly reduce travel time, fostering economic growth and enhancing connectivity for business and tourism.

Corridor Features

Advanced Infrastructure – The corridor is being built with advanced engineering and technology, including elevated tracks, tunnels, and bridges. It incorporates the Japanese Shinkansen technology, known for its safety and punctuality, setting a new standard for rail travel in India.

Practical Info for Travelers

Reduced Travel Time – Upon completion, the corridor is projected to drastically cut down travel time between Mumbai and Ahmedabad. Future travelers can anticipate a journey of approximately 2-3 hours, a significant reduction compared to existing modes of transport. Specific schedules and booking details will be available closer to its operational launch.
